To: All CEOs/CFOs/General Managers of British Columbia Authorized Credit Unions
Re: Capital Adequacy Return - New Filing Requirements
In 2013, the Financial Institutions Commission (FICOM) conducted a review of the Capital
Adequacy Return (CAR). As a result of the review, FICOM proposed to implement changes to
CAR and invited the BC Credit Unions to submit their comments. In June 2014, FICOM sent a
letter to the BC Credit Unions indicating that we will be implementing audit requirement for
CAR effective 2016 year-end.
FICOM is now issuing an updated version of its CAR and Completion Guide. Effective for the
2016 fiscal year, FICOM will require credit unions to obtain and file an annual audit report of its
CAR.
FICOM will post the Completion Guide and CAR on the web site and encourages credit unions
to share these documents with its external auditors for planning purposes.
Financial institutions are expected to be aware of its regulatory requirements, including its
statutory filings deadlines and requirements, and to comply with them. The CAR is subject to
FICOM'sNon-Compliant Filings Administrative Penalty Guideline.
